PixWorld โ Unifying 3D Scene Generation & Reconstruction in Pixel Space.
Prior work splits the two into different spaces โ reconstruction in pixel space, generation in latent space. PixWorld unifies both in one pixel-space diffusion model, and instead of optimizing an intermediate latent it optimizes directly into a 3D representation via differentiable rendering (no VAE/RAE).
โก 4-step distilled โ ~0.6 s/scene, up to ~1000ร faster than diffusion world models.
